Efficient transition from partial nitritation to partial nitritation/Anammox in a membrane bioreactor with activated sludge as the sole seed source.

Published in 2020 at "Chemosphere"

DOI: 10.1016/j.chemosphere.2020.126719

Abstract: A lab-scale membrane bioreactor (MBR) was employed to carry out the partial nitritation/Anammox (PN/A) process from conventional activated sludge. Seed sludge was cultivated under microaerobic conditions for 10 days before seeding into the MBR. The… read more here.

Efficient Transition State Optimization of Periodic Structures through Automated Relaxed Potential Energy Surface Scans.

Published in 2018 at "Journal of chemical theory and computation"

DOI: 10.1021/acs.jctc.7b01070

Abstract: This work explores how constrained linear combinations of bond lengths can be used to optimize transition states in periodic structures. Scanning of constrained coordinates is a standard approach for molecular codes with localized basis functions,… read more here.

Hydrazo coupling: the efficient transition-metal-free C–H functionalization of 8-hydroxyquinoline and phenol through base catalysis

Published in 2019 at "Green Chemistry"

DOI: 10.1039/c9gc02824b

Abstract: A new reaction involving the quantitative coupling of phenolic substrates to azodicarboxylate esters under mild conditions is a facile route for obtaining hydrazine derivatives. A plausible mechanism, catalysts, scope and application are discussed. read more here.
